On 05/27/2014 07:24 PM, Maurizio Lombardi wrote:
> On Tue, May 27, 2014 at 10:43:59AM +0200, Maurizio Lombardi wrote:
>>
>> But now I'm suspicious of this part of commit 3979ef4dcf:
>>
>> failed:
>> bvec->bv_page = NULL;
>> bvec->bv_len = 0;
>> bvec->bv_offset = 0;
>> bio->bi_vcnt--; <----------------
>> blk_recount_segments(q, bio);
>> return 0;
>>
>> Is decreasing bi_vcnt sufficient to guarantee that blk_recount_segments()
>> recalculates the correct number of physical segments?
>> Looking at the __blk_recalc_rq_segments() it appears it may not be the case.
>>
>> The question is how can we restore the correct number of physical segments in case
>> of failure without breaking anything...
>>
>
> If my hypothesis is correct, the following patch should trigger a kernel panic,
> Jet Chen, can you try it and let me know whether the BUG_ON is hit or not?
